Transaction d6eb5d084873713b0cdf1bc0bf89f8b82e97eff3ced1277d78c83fe375df8a5a
1 Input
1 Outputs
- d6eb5d084873713b0cdf1bc0bf89f8b82e97eff3ced1277d78c83fe375df8a5a:0
value 30317349
address 3GB5dT1DEJWVztANtH5AAbfn4TAcVAVjL6